About this work

A busy harbor scene shows ships, docks, and buildings under a cloudy sky. Soft lines and cross-hatching create depth in the water. Tiny figures and rigging fill the scene but stay clear. This is an etching, a print made by scratching lines into metal. It’s printed on laid paper, which has a woven texture you can feel. Few artists mixed etching so smoothly with such detail.
